3 Operation
3.1
Handling the SP Module A
General
The
SP Module A
of the
793 Sample Prep Module
consists of a total
of three cation exchange units which are in turn used for cation ex-
change, regenerated and rinsed with water. In order to record each new
chromatogram under comparable conditions a freshly regenerated
cation exchange unit is normally used. Switching is either carried out
automatically together with valve switching or manually.

Flow direction
The cation exchange units must never be regenerated in the same
flow direction used for the sample. You should thus always install the
inlet and outlet capillaries as described in sections 2.3.2 or 2.4.2
respectively according to the scheme shown in Fig. 6.
Never switch when dry
The SP Module A must never be switched in the dry state as there is
a danger of blocking.
No recycling
The recycling process (returning the eluent to the storage vessel)
must not be carried out when the SP Module A is in operation.
